msm: mdss: dsi: enable LPRX and CDRX only for logical data lane 0



The low power receiver (LPRX) and contention detection receiver (CDRX)
need to be enabled only for the physical data lane corresponding to the
logical data lane 0. Modify the code to implement this while accounting
for any possible data lane swap configurations.
